North Pigeon Cr Watershed Site 17

North Pigeon Cr Watershed Site 17 is an earth dam located in Pottawattamie County, Iowa, built in 1973. It carries a Low hazard potential classification.

About North Pigeon Cr Watershed Site 17

The primary purpose of North Pigeon Cr Watershed Site 17 is fire protection, stock, or small fish pond. The dam maintains a small impoundment used for fire suppression, livestock watering, or as a fish pond. The dam is owned by West Pottawattamie County Swcd (local government). It impounds the Tr- Pigeon Creek near Crescent.

The dam stands 66 feet tall, creates a reservoir covering 1 acres, has a maximum storage capacity of 18 acre-feet, and collects water from a drainage area of 0 square miles. Completed in 1973, the structure is well into its service life at over 50 years old.

This dam has a low hazard potential classification, meaning that failure would cause minimal damage, limited primarily to the dam owner's property, with no expected loss of life.

At 66 feet, this dam is taller than 96% of all dams in the United States.
